Philodendron Baudoense Care Tips
If you’re considering bringing a Philodendron baudoense into your home, it’s essential to understand its care requirements. With proper care, your Philodendron baudoense will thrive and add beauty to your space. Here are some care tips to keep in mind:
Light Requirements
Philodendron baudoense prefers bright, indirect light. Avoid direct sunlight as it can damage the leaves. If your plant is not getting enough light, the leaves may turn yellow or droop.
Watering Needs
Water your Philodendron baudoense when the top inch of the soil feels dry. Be sure not to overwater, as this can lead to root rot. You can also mist the leaves occasionally to increase humidity.
Temperature Preferences
Philodendron baudoense thrives in temperatures between 65-80°F (18-27°C). Keep your plant away from cold drafts or hot, dry air from heaters or air conditioners.
Soil Conditions
Plant your Philodendron baudoense in well-draining soil, as waterlogged soil can harm the plant. You can use a mixture of peat moss, perlite, and coarse sand to create a suitable soil mix.
Additionally, it’s essential to fertilize your Philodendron baudoense every 2-3 months during the growing season (spring to fall). Use a balanced fertilizer at half-strength to avoid overfertilization.
How to Propagate Philodendron Baudoense
If you want to expand your collection of Philodendron baudoense or share it with friends, propagation is a great option. There are two main methods to propagate Philodendron baudoense: stem cuttings and division.
Propagate with Stem Cuttings
Propagating Philodendron baudoense with stem cuttings is relatively simple and can result in a new plant in a matter of weeks. Here is a step-by-step guide:
Materials needed: | Sharp, clean scissors | Small container filled with water or potting mix |
---|---|---|
Steps: | 1. Locate a healthy stem with several leaves and nodes. | 2. Use scissors to make a clean cut just below a node. |
3. Remove the bottom leaves to expose the node. | 4. Place the cutting in a container with water or potting mix, making sure the node is submerged or in contact with the mix. | |
5. Place the container in a bright, warm spot with indirect sunlight. | 6. Change the water every few days or keep the potting mix moist until roots develop. | |
7. Once the cutting develops roots, transfer it to a larger pot with well-draining soil. |
It’s important to note that Philodendron baudoense can be prone to stem rot, so be careful not to overwater the cutting during propagation.
Propagate with Division
Propagation by division is another option for Philodendron baudoense and can be effective for mature plants that have outgrown their pot. Here is a step-by-step guide:
Materials needed: | Gloves | Sharp, clean scissors or knife | Potting mix | New pot |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Steps: | 1. Put on gloves to protect your hands. | 2. Carefully remove the plant from its current pot. | 3. Using clean scissors or a knife, separate the plant into two or more sections, making sure each section has roots and several leaves. | 4. Fill a new pot with fresh potting mix. | 5. Place each section of the plant in the new pot and fill around it with potting mix, making sure the plant is stable and upright. |
6. Water the newly potted sections and place in a bright spot with indirect sunlight. | 7. Continue to care for each section as you would with a mature Philodendron baudoense plant. |
Propagation by division should be done in the spring when the plant is actively growing and can adjust to its new environment more easily.

Philodendron Baudoense Growth Patterns
Philodendron baudoense is known for its upright growth habit and can reach a height of 3-4 feet with a spread of 2-3 feet. Its leaves are large, reaching up to 12 inches in length, and are held on sturdy stems. As the plant matures, it may produce aerial roots, which can be used to support the plant and enhance its tropical look.
Philodendron baudoense is a relatively slow-growing plant, but with proper care, it can produce new leaves regularly. Expect to see a new leaf every 2-3 weeks during the growing season, which typically runs from spring to fall.
While Philodendron baudoense can tolerate a variety of light conditions, it will grow best in bright, indirect light. Direct sunlight can scorch the leaves, while too little light can slow growth and lead to leggy stems.
As with other Philodendron species, Philodendron baudoense prefers soil that is consistently moist but not waterlogged. Water when the top inch of soil becomes dry, and be sure to provide good drainage to prevent root rot.
